Nature and Adventure
For outdoor lovers, Gippsland is pure magic. Wilsons Promontory, affectionately known as “The Prom,” is a must-visit, boasting secluded beaches, epic hiking trails and crystal-clear waters. If you're craving coastal bliss, the Ninety Mile Beach is one of the world’s longest, offering unspoiled stretches of sand where you can truly unwind. Meanwhile, the Gippsland Lakes provide the perfect setting for kayaking, boating or spotting Burrunan dolphins in their natural habitat.
Food, Wine and Local Charm
Gippsland’s food scene is a celebration of local produce, with farm-fresh delights, boutique wineries and warm, inclusive hospitality. Stop by a vineyard in the rolling hills of West Gippsland, sample artisan cheeses in charming country towns or enjoy a long lunch at one of the many LGBTQ+-friendly cafés and restaurants dotted throughout the region.
Arts, Culture and Community
Gippsland is home to a thriving creative community, with galleries, markets and festivals that champion diverse voices. The region has a growing LGBTQ+ presence, with welcoming spaces and events that celebrate inclusivity. You’ll find queer-friendly bars, art spaces and events in hubs like Warragul and Traralgon, ensuring that no matter where you go, there’s a sense of belonging.
